Dynamics of lithium electrode passivation in aprotic organic electrolytes,studied by electrochemical noise method
Authors:L. S. Kanevskii  B. M. Grafov
Affiliation:(1) Frumkin Institute of Physical Chemistry and Electrochemistry, Russian Academy of Sciences, Leninskii pr. 31, Moscow, 119991, Russia
Abstract:Lithium electrode passivation is studied in different organic electrolytes, namely, 1 M LiClO4 in 1,3-dioxolane, 1 M LiN(CF3SO2)2 in 1,3-dioxolane, 1 M LiPF6 in an ethylene carbonate-diethyl carbonate mixture, 1 M LiPF6 in an ethylene carbonate-dimethyl carbonate mixture, using the electrochemical noise method. The dynamics of passive film formation on the lithium surface in the mentioned electrolytes that differ in their corrosivity towards lithium is followed.
Keywords:electrochemical noise  lithium electrode  electrode passivation  aprotic organic electrolytes
